The core appeal of IMEI Tracker 4.1 lies in its promise of independence from the device’s software state. Most standard tracking applications require the phone to be powered on, connected to the internet, and signed into a specific account. However, an IMEI tracker theoretically interfaces with GSM and CDMA networks. By identifying the unique 15-digit code assigned to a device’s physical radio, this version of tracking software aims to locate a handset through cell tower triangulation. This means that even if a thief performs a factory reset or swaps the SIM card, the hardware's "digital fingerprint" remains constant and detectable by the network provider. If you still have your phone, dial *#06# into the keypad to display the IMEI number. If the phone is already lost, look for the fifteen-digit number on the original product box, the purchase receipt, or your wireless carrier account dashboard.
